**Mgmt Meeting Minutes — Retiring the Brightline Range**

Quick recap for sales leads at Fenholt Supplies: we agreed to retire the Brightline fixture range by year-end. Remaining stock moves to clearance pricing next month, and accounts on standing orders get migrated to the Lumetta range. Trade-in incentives were approved in principle. The confidential note on next steps sits just below.

board note of bajof-bajeg: The pricing group signed off on a budget of $13.4 million for Project Sildor. The renewal with Lamixek Holdings closes at $48.9 million a year, 49 percent above the last contract.

### v4.2 — Changed defaults

Quick one for support: the Ledgerlight audit-log viewer now defaults to a 7-day window instead of 30, and redacted fields are hidden rather than masked. Expect tickets from folks who think entries vanished — they didn't. Point them at the date picker. The new default settings ship as follows.

settings of tagef-bawif:
DRUIX_HOST=druix.zemvarlabs.internal
DRUIX_PORT=8000

Ticket: Staging env misconfigured for Siftgate bloom filter

The bloom layer in front of the Pellet KV store is rejecting all lookups in staging because the env file was copied from the dev template without credentials. False-positive tuning values are fine; only the auth line is missing. To unblock the weekly demo, the Pellet admission secret must be set on the following line.

env line for yaguf-fajop: LEDGER_TOKEN13=fb08984397349

## Idempotency Keys for Payment Retries (Lumopay)

Every retry of a charge request must reuse the original idempotency key; generating a new key on retry can produce duplicate charges. Keys are scoped per merchant and expire after 48 hours. Reviewers should verify keys are derived server-side, never from client input. The full key-generation specification and threat model are maintained on the internal page.

dashboard of kaguf-tawip = https://vault.merlaqsys.test/issue

**Vendor note: Inkmill markdown pipeline**

Rendering for Parchway docs is outsourced to Inkmill under an annual contract, renewing each March. They handle sanitization and PDF export; we own the upload queue. SLA: 4-hour response on rendering failures. Escalate only after two failed retries. Their support desk is reachable at the address below.

billing contact of hahaf-baguf = zorael.tammir.jorius@sivrelhq.internal